As of April 04, 2026, there are 124 low-income housing units approved and available at Promenade, an affordable housing complex in West Covina, California. Rental prices vary from $533 to $1.080 and are available to individuals who meet certain income and eligibility criteria.
*Rent estimates are calculated using Los Angeles County Fair Market Rents for 2026 and assume the 30% extremely low income threshold is met. This means that the tenant will be responsible for 30% of the Fair Market Rent for this unit. It is recommended to contact the Housing Authority of the City of Lomita for exact rent pricing.
